Boeing delivered Emirates’ 78th 777 on July 29th, the airline’s 45th 777-300ER (Extended Range). The Dubai-based carrier is now the world’s largest operator of the 777 and the only airline to operate every model type, with an additional nine 777-200s, 12 777-300s, 10 777-200LRs (Longer Range) and two 777 Freighters in its fleet. Emirates also has an additional 28 Boeing 777s on order, valued at more than $7 billion at current list prices.
